About First Western Trust.

First Western's mission is to be the best private bank for the western wealth management client. We believe that each of our clients shares our entrepreneurial spirit and values our sophisticated, high-touch wealth management services that are tailored to meet their specific needs. We provide a trusted adviser platform with an established approach to investment management through a branded network of boutique private trust bank offices located across Colorado, Arizona, Wyoming and California.

Headquartered in Denver, Colorado, we provide a fully integrated suite of wealth management services on a private trust bank platform, which includes a comprehensive selection of deposit, loan, trust, wealth planning and investment management products and services.

You can find us trading on the NASDAQ Global Select Market under the symbol "MYFW."

Job Responsibilities:


  • Conduct more complex client interactions including service, new accounts, and on-going relationships for both depository and lending clients, including those involving debit cards, online banking, and general account inquiries.

  • May oversee and direct work of Private Banker I team members.

  • Solve more complex service issues with minimal direction and guidance.

  • Actively seek cross-sell opportunities.

  • Assist in training and developing Private Banker I associates (if applicable).

  • Successfully perform teller functions, cash handling, security, on-line banking, wire transfers, and open new accounts.

  • Identify treasury management opportunities, implement recommendations and assist commercial clients.

  • May assist with the development of new business by participating in client and/or prospect calls and presentations.

  • Assist with lending opportunities by requesting client documents; act as a liaison for clients, the profit center, and operations associates.

  • Interact with team members from various departments; specifically, deposit operations, loan operations, compliance, and security.

  • Maintain current knowledge of and comply with all applicable laws and regulations, policies and procedures

  • May be asked to serve as primary contact for profit center's physical security by training associates, adhering to security standards, providing internal communication of security changes, and acting as the after-hours contact for the security system.

Required Skills & Experience:


  • Bachelor's Degree in Business, Finance or related field; may be offset by additional years of banking experience required


  • 3-5 years client-facing banking experience required

  • Notary Within 90 days of hire required

  • Proficient with Microsoft Office Suite

  • Detailed knowledge of teller functions, client services, new deposit accounts, banking regulations and compliance

  • Detail-oriented, organized and able to multi-task

  • Self-starter
